Henry Witcomb represented the family of Diana Mager at the Inquest into her death. She had a history of depression and suffered post-natal depression after giving birth in 2011. She was admitted to Green Parks House in Kent. During the course of her admission a number of incidents occurred in the week before her death including being found on the ledge of the fifth floor members’ balcony of the Tate Modern and then, on another day, being found with a knife which she had hidden in her room. Monitoring during this period and during the night when she died continued to be intermittent and not on a one to one basis.
